Exploring the Mechanics of Pin Micro Servo Drivers
Pin micro servo drivers operate on a interesting interplay of electrical signals and mechanical movement.These compact devices are designed to translate precise commands into tangible actions, making them essential for numerous applications ranging from robotics to automated hobby projects. What sets them apart is their ability to achieve high precision through simple pin configuration, which allows users to manipulate the angle and speed of the servo motors with remarkable accuracy.
Understanding the core mechanics of these drivers involves delving into their architecture. Pin micro servo drivers typically consist of a control circuit, power supply, and motor driver module. Each component plays a critical role in ensuring that the servo responds appropriately to the input signals it receives. Below is a breakdown of the components involved:
| Component | Function |
|---|---|
| Control Circuit | Decodes input signals and generates corresponding control pulses. |
| power Supply | Supplies the necessary voltage and current to the servo motor. |
| Motor Driver Module | Converts input signals into motion, allowing for precise control. |
This intricate design enables users to implement custom control commands using various programming platforms, making pin micro servo drivers not just effective but also highly adaptable. as a result, they support a multitude of configurations tailored to specific tasks. enhancing Performance with Expert Calibration Techniques
Achieving optimal performance with pin micro servo drivers requires precise calibration techniques that can enhance accuracy and responsiveness. These calibration methods are essential not only for maximizing functionality but also for ensuring that the driver aligns with the specific needs of any given project.Some effective strategies include:
- software Calibration: Adjusting the parameters in the software that controls the servo can fine-tune the response and improve overall performance.
- mechanical Alignment: Ensuring that the servo is physically aligned with the mechanism it operates can decrease wear and improve efficiency.
- Feedback Integration: Incorporating feedback systems helps in monitoring performance in real-time, allowing for dynamic adjustments.
Calibration also plays a critical role in the longevity and reliability of pin micro servo drivers. Regular calibration checks can considerably reduce the risk of failure due to drift or misalignment. It’s recommended to periodically perform the following checks:
| Calibration Aspect | Frequency | Recommended Tools |
|---|---|---|
| Software Parameter Review | Every 6 Months | Computer with Calibration Software |
| Mechanical Alignment Check | Quarterly | calipers, rulers |
| Feedback Calibration Test | Monthly | Oscilloscope, Multimeter |

Q1: What are pin micro servo drivers, and how do they work?
A1: Pin micro servo drivers are specialized electronic components designed to control micro servos with remarkable precision. They function by interpreting signals from a microcontroller or any compatible input device, converting these signals into specific instructions for the servo motor. The driver precisely modulates the voltage and current, enabling the servo to move to exact angles or positions.This precise control is crucial for applications ranging from robotics to hobbyist projects.
Q2: What advantages do pin micro servo drivers offer over traditional servo controllers?
A2: One of the key advantages of pin micro servo drivers is their compact size and lightweight design,making them ideal for projects where space is limited. Additionally, they provide greater flexibility in terms of control. Users can easily adjust parameters like speed and torque, allowing for tailored performance specific to the intended application. Their ease of integration with various microcontrollers further enhances their appeal, simplifying complex projects without sacrificing functionality.
Q3: Can you describe some common applications for pin micro servo drivers?
A3: Pin micro servo drivers find applications across a wide range of domains. In robotics, they are used for controlling limb movements, thereby enhancing the lifelike performance of robotic models. in the realm of automation, they can be deployed in systems that require precise mechanical adjustments, such as camera mounts or remote-controlled vehicles. They are also popular in DIY projects and educational kits, allowing individuals to explore engineering concepts in a hands-on manner.
Q4: Are there any limitations to using pin micro servo drivers?
A4: while pin micro servo drivers are incredibly versatile, they do have some limitations. One primary consideration is the torque and load capacity of the connected servos. If overburdened, the servos may fail to operate effectively or become damaged. Additionally,there can be challenges related to feedback and control in more complex systems,requiring advanced programming and tuning. Ensuring that the chosen driver and servo are compatible is crucial to achieving optimal performance.
